Banc of California, Inc. - Form 8-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Current Report on Form 8-K was filed by Banc of California, Inc. (a Maryland corporation) on April 23, 2014. The report discloses material events occurring on April 22 and April 23, 2014, including regulatory disclosures and a significant acquisition agreement.
Key Financial Metrics
The filing text does not provide specific financial metrics such as revenue, profit, cash flow, margins, debt, or liquidity figures. This report serves to announce a corporate event rather than report periodic financial results.
Material Changes and Events
- Acquisition Agreement: On April 22, 2014, Banc of California, National Association (the Bank) entered into a Purchase and Assumption Agreement with Banco Popular North America (BPOP).
- Transaction Details: The Bank agreed to acquire certain assets and assume certain liabilities associated with specific BPOP branches located in California.
- Regulatory Disclosure: The Company furnished an investor presentation (Exhibit 99.1) under Regulation FD.
